Ark. court upholds fines against payday lender
The Arkansas Supreme Court affirmed a circuit judge's 2007 ruling ordering Dennis Bailey to pay the fines to the Arkansas State Board of Collection Agencies, which found he operated 14 payday lending outlets ...
